Symbolism and Tensions in Northern Ireland's Effigy Tradition

This chapter explores the contentious subject of effigies displayed during the marching season in Northern Ireland, particularly examining the symbolism linked to immigration issues. It highlights the historical significance of bonfires in the context of the Orange Order and presents the dualities of cultural expression and political representation in contemporary society. The discussion reflects on recent unrest, community sentiments, and the complexities of governance within the politically charged landscape of Northern Ireland.
